Opinion
It is quite evident that the decision of the Circuit Court was made in the exercise of its superintending and revising jurisdiction, and this court decided at the last term, in Morgan v. Thornhill, that-no appeal can be taken from the decision of the Circuit Court in the exercise of that jurisdiction. The appeal, therefore, is
Dismissed.
